Why does Peanut Butter Chocolate have a Nutri-Score of D?

Nutri-Score weighs negatives (calories, sugar, saturated fat, sodium) against positives (fiber, protein) per 100 g. Points against come from calorie density (613 kcal), saturated fat (8.7 g), sodium (640 mg); points in favor come from fiber (7.6 g), protein (21 g). Overall that places it in band D.
